Advanced Composite Technology – Giant’s High Performance Grade raw carbon material is used to produce this custom frame material in their own composite factory with a high stiffness-to-weight ratio. The front triangle of these framesets is assembled and molded as one continuous piece in a proprietary manufacturing process called Modified Monocoque Construction.
Advanced Forged Composite Technology – A state-of-the-art high-pressure molding process is used to produce complex-shaped carbon fiber components that are lighter, stiffer and stronger than similar components made from aluminum. This technology is used in critical performance parts such as Maestro Suspension rocker links.
OverDrive – Giant’s original oversized fork steerer tube technology. Designed to provide precise front-end steering performance, the system’s oversized headset bearings (1 1/4” lower and 1 1/8” upper for road, 1 1/2” lower and 1 1/8” upper for mountain) and tapered steerer tube work in conjunction to provide optimal steering stiffness.

Fox Float DPS Performance Shock – This shock features a lightweight, one-piece EVOL air sleeve for responsiveness and sensitivity, a dual piston design, and Fox's proven DPS damper. Performance Series FLOAT DPS shocks have fewer adjustments than Factory Series (no Open mode adjust tuning range), and have black anodized air sleeve and body instead of Genuine Kashima Coat. A Performance graphics package ties in the black-on-black look.
Shock Adjustments – Air Spring Pressure / Lever Actuated Open, Medium, Firm Modes / Rebound

Giant TR-1 Wheelset – Carrying over much of the same technology from their carbon off-road wheels, Giant’s all-new TR1 alloy Wheel system provides strength and reliability at an outstanding value. Based around 110mm and 148mm hubs, with a 30mm internal rim width to allow for wide-trail tires, the TR1 wheel features a freshly redesigned and more robust weld joint, giving you the control and confidence you seek; any trail, any time.

Maxxis Minion DHR II Rear Tire – With side knobs borrowed from the legendary Minion DHF, but widened to provide more support, the DHR II corners like no other. The center tread features ramped leading edges to improve acceleration and sipes to create a smooth transition when leaning the bike. Paddle-like knobs on the center tread dig in under hard braking and help keep the bike under control. Pair it with a Minion DHF up front for the ultimate aggressive trail riding tire combo!
